Symptoms of both types are similar, and it's important to have a doctor check your symptoms, because untreated diabetes can cause serious complications.
  1. Weight Loss

    • Weight loss that cannot be attributed to a change in diet or exercise routine may be a sign that you are diabetic.

    Frequent Urination

    • One symptom of diabetes that many people experience is a drastic increase in urination.

    Hunger and Thirst

    • If you are suddenly always hungry and/or thirsty, it could be a sign you are a diabetic.

    Vision Changes

    • Some diabetics experience blurry or distorted vision prior to diagnosis and treatment.

    Fatigue

    • If you find are extremely tired and weak, it may be a sign of diabetes.
